The present report is being submitted pursuant to General Assembly resolution 74/165 of 18 December 2019, entitled “Effective promotion of the Declaration on the Rights of Persons Belonging to National or Ethnic, Religious and Linguistic Minorities”. The period covered by the present report has included the momentous impacts of the coronavirus disease (COVID-19) pandemic, which has disproportionately affected minorities and continues to expose deeply rooted structural discrimination, triggering increased attention to minorities and their rights under international human rights law. It recommends, inter alia, that Member States commit to collecting and analyzing comprehensive disaggregated data in order to tailor legislation, policies and programmes to better protect minority rights.
